Industry Applications of Fuse Accessories
Fuse accessories find extensive use across various industries. In the electrical and electronics industry, they safeguard delicate components from power surges. Automotive systems rely on them for protecting intricate vehicular electrical circuits. Industrial machinery utilizes these accessories to prevent catastrophic failures due to overloads or short-circuits. Even renewable energy setups like solar and wind installations count on fuse accessories for safe, efficient operation.
